Background
The transformer is a device for changing alternating voltage by utilizing the principle of electromagnetic induction, main components are a primary coil, a secondary coil and an iron core, and the transformer has the following main functions: voltage transformation, current transformation, impedance transformation, isolation, voltage stabilization, and the like; according to the application, the method can be divided into: power transformers and special transformers (furnace transformers, rectification transformers, power frequency test transformers, voltage regulators, mining transformers, audio transformers, intermediate frequency transformers, high frequency transformers, impulse transformers, instrument transformers, electronic transformers, reactors, transformers, etc.); the transformer is widely used, so that the fixing device is necessary, and the installation stability of the transformer and the convenience of later maintenance and repair treatment are considered.

As shown in the figures 1-2, the transformer fixing device convenient to install comprises a placing bin 1, at least two hydraulic cylinders 2 are arranged on the inner walls of two sides of the placing bin 1 respectively, a first fixing piece 3 is arranged at the output end of the hydraulic cylinder 2 close to the inner wall of one side of the placing bin 1, a second fixing piece 4 is arranged at the output end of the hydraulic cylinder 2 close to the inner wall of the other side of the placing bin 1, a fixture block 5 is arranged on the side wall of the first fixing piece 3, a clamping groove 6 is formed in the side wall of the second fixing piece 4, the hydraulic cylinder 2 pushes the two fixing pieces to move, the two fixing pieces are connected with the clamping groove 6 through the fixture block 5, four limit blocks 7 are fixed on the inner wall of the upper portion of the placing bin 1, push blocks 8 are respectively arranged on the upper portions of the first fixing, The screw bin 10 is fixedly arranged on the side wall of the placing bin 1, the driving motor 11 is connected to the inner wall of the upper portion of the screw bin 10, the bearing seat 12 is mounted on the inner wall of the lower portion of the screw bin 10, one end of the screw 13 is connected to the bearing seat 12, the other end of the screw 13 is connected to the driving end of the driving motor 11, the screw slider 14 is connected to the screw 13 through threads, a connecting rod sliding groove 16 is formed in the side wall of the screw bin 10, one end of the connecting rod 15 is connected to the screw slider 14, and the other end of the connecting rod 15 penetrates through the connecting rod sliding groove 16 and is connected to the; the push block 8 is clamped between the two limiting blocks 7, and the limiting blocks 7 play a certain guiding role on the push block 8; the two groups of fastening devices 9 are arranged by taking the central axis of the placing bin 1 as a symmetrical axis, and the two groups of fastening devices 9 have better fastening effect; the clamping groove 6 is an oblong clamping groove, the clamping block 5 is an oblong clamping block, and the clamping block 5 can be clamped in the clamping groove 6; the connecting rod 15 and the connecting rod chute 16 are arranged above the placing bin 1.
During the specific use, the staff places the transformer and places between mounting one 3 and the mounting two 4 in placing storehouse 1, start hydraulic cylinder 2, pneumatic cylinder 2 promotes mounting one 3 and two 4 relative motion of mounting, fixture block 5 joint on the mounting one 3 is gone into in mounting two 4, stop hydraulic cylinder 2 when pressing from both sides tightly soon, start driving motor 11, driving motor 11 drives lead screw 13 and rotates on bearing frame 12, threaded slide 14 passes through threaded connection and moves on connecting rod 15, connecting rod 15 promotes ejector pad 8 and removes to the transformer direction, make ejector pad 8 promote the transformer and remove to keeping away from 7 directions of stopper, start hydraulic cylinder 2 at last, make mounting one 3 and mounting two 4 fasten the transformer, the installation is very convenient, it is also very convenient to dismantle the maintenance.
